๐Ÿ’ฐ Investment Fraud: The Scale of the Problem

The SEC and FTC consistently report that investment fraud causes some of the largest individual losses of any consumer scam category. Unlike a purchase scam that costs hundreds of dollars, investment fraud victims routinely lose tens of thousands โ€” or hundreds of thousands โ€” of dollars. Victims are often targeted specifically because they have savings, are approaching retirement, or are looking for ways to grow their money.

The schemes are diverse: cryptocurrency investment platforms that disappear with deposited funds, “financial advisors” operating without licenses who collect fees and vanish, fake stock opportunities promoted through social media and messaging apps, and sophisticated Ponzi-style operations that run for months or years before collapsing.

In many cases, victims believe the money is simply gone. But the person who took it is often identifiable โ€” especially in the early stages before the operation fully dissolves.

๐Ÿ’ก Why Investment Scammers Leave Traces

Investment fraud requires more interaction and documentation than simpler scams โ€” which creates more identifying data. An investment scammer typically provides a name (often real), a phone number or email for ongoing communication, a website or business identity, and in some cases bank account information for wire transfers. Each of these is a thread that professional investigation can follow.

โš ๏ธ Report to Authorities โ€” And Investigate Simultaneously

Investment fraud should be reported to the SEC (sec.gov/tcr), the FBI at IC3.gov, the FTC at reportfraud.ftc.gov, and your state securities regulator.
